I have been looking to change the wheels for sometime now... I found a set for a good price and want to know you opinion's.
My Car: 1997 Infiniti Q45
My suspension: Tein S-Tech Springs
My Wheel of Choice: Stich Evolution's... the fronts are 18x10 -6 and the rears are 18x12 -7
My Tire of Choice (thanks rich): front 225/40/18 and rear either 255/35/18 or 265/35/18
Work needed? I have pm'ed a couple of members and the suggest I roll both front and rear fenders and have slight pull to the rear. Max camber front and rear via pillow mounts (front) and rear adjustable camber arms (S13/S14/Z32).
Did I do my research? What did I miss?

Not that I'm some sort of fitment guru, but where do you pull these ideas from? Judging by previous people's fitments, these wheels CAN be fit with relatively stock fenders. Benji's rears were only 3mm more sunken than these, and he fit them with a 1/4" pull and around 7.5 degrees of camber. Grant's fronts are 4mm more sunken, and he's running stock fenders AFAIK. To pull 2 inches is not only damn-near impossible, but utterly ridiculous for wheels like this.
